2017-03-17 158 views
0

聲納掃描儀無法完成掃描。我檢查了日誌,發現掃描卡在一個文件中,如下所示SonarQube掃描儀在AST掃描期間卡在一個java文件中

信息:977/6093文件分析,當前文件:C:\ Projects \ ABC \ src \ main \ java.com.cmp.rpt .Report.java

掃描儀不斷打印此消息,掃描從不結束。 這是最近的一個問題。我查看了該文件的歷史記錄,並且該文件中沒有任何更改。我最近更新了Sonar中的Java插件。 我的服務器配置如下圖

SonarQube掃描儀2.8(2.9嘗試也沒有成功)

SonarQube的Java插件版本4.6.0.8784

SonarQube服務器5.6.5

任何人都可以棚在這個問題上的一些光

更新:我恢復SonarQube java插件回到3.13.1和掃描儀能夠繼續。所以問題是在新的Java插件4.6.0.8784

+0

你能分享記錄的文件嗎?您可以聯繫[email protected](並刪除此問題)以獲得答案並將其私密發送給SonarJava的開發人員之一。 – benzonico

+0

不幸的是,我無法分享java源文件。除了源文件,我可以提供什麼,以便你們可以複製這個問題。 – Vahid

回答

0

只是回答我的問題,以澄清。

我一直在測試我遇到問題後發佈的不同版本,最後在下面的更新中問題得到修復。

將SonarQube掃描儀更新至3.0.1.733,將SonarJavaPlugin更新至4.8.0.9441.jar解決了此問題。

1

我有同樣的問題。 當我更新到sonar-java-plugin-4.11版本 和sonar-scanner.3.0版本, 時,問題得到解決。